Canada Launches Digital Visa Pilot Project

The Canadian government has introduced a pilot project to test digital visas, aiming to simplify the visa application process by eliminating the need to send or present a passport in person. According to Canadian authorities, these visas "make travel faster, safer, and more convenient" by only requiring necessary information.

Pilot Project Details

For this test, Morocco has been chosen as the partner country. A small number of Moroccan citizens who have obtained a visitor visa may be offered a digital version of their visa, in addition to the traditional sticker. If the trial is successful, this new approach could be extended to other countries.

Simplified Entry for Certain Travelers with eTA

The Canadian government is also offering a simplified solution for certain travelers: the Electronic Travel Authorization (eTA). This procedure allows citizens of certain countries to travel to Canada without needing a traditional visa, provided they meet specific criteria.

Who Can Apply for an eTA?

The eTA is available for travelers who:

  • Have obtained a Canadian visitor visa in the last 10 years or hold a valid US visa
  • Are traveling to Canada for a temporary stay (up to 6 months maximum)
  • Are flying to Canada or will be transiting through a Canadian airport with a valid passport

Eligible Countries for eTA

The following countries are eligible for an eTA:

  • Antigua and Barbuda
  • Argentina
  • Brazil
  • Costa Rica
  • Mexico
  • Panama
  • Philippines
  • Saint Kitts and Nevis
  • Saint Lucia
  • Saint Vincent and the Grenadines
  • Seychelles
  • Thailand
  • Trinidad and Tobago
  • Uruguay

If these criteria are not met, travelers will need to apply for a visitor visa. This initiative aims to simplify access to Canada for air travelers from countries that require a visa.

Recent Update

Recently, citizens of Qatar have been added to the list of eligible countries. They no longer need a visitor visa and can apply for an eTA to travel to Canada.
